NGCI has a new Addition to the Executive Team

MASKWACIS, AB - Neyaskweyahk Group of Companies Inc. (NGCI) is thrilled to have a new VP Business Development join the Executive Team. The VP Business Development will assist in the development, implementation, and execution of new and existing businesses and works closely with the Chief Executive Officer, Vice President of Operations and Financial Controller.    Stephen Wagner, NGCI’s new VP Business Development, started with NGCI on November 18, 2021. NGCI’S Business Partner, Abacus Power Ltd, Donate to Ermineskin Food Bank

Maskwacis, AB, November 9, 2021 – Neyaskweyahk Group of Companies Inc. announces that the Abacus Power Ltd, a renewable energy company, has donated $1000 to Ermineskin Food Bank to support the community initiative of Ermineskin Cree Nation (ECN).It is widely known that food banks across Canada have been severely impacted by COVID-19. ECN have facing increased demand for support throughout this pandemic. The staff at Ermineskin Food Bank are working tirelessly to serve those who rely on their services to feel safe and healthy.
